Electrical Technician at Kimberly Clark in Northfleet. Join the team behind iconic brands like Huggies, Kleenex, Cottonelle, Scott, Kotex, Poise, Depend, Andrex, and the Kimberly Clark Professional brands. As an Electrical Technician you will be preventing and fixing problems on high speed machines that produce top notch products for 1% of the world's population. You'll be recognized by your manager, supported by your team, and see the products you produce being used by your own family at the end of the day.


In this day based role you will report to the Asset Leader and safely execute the activities required to deliver the mill reliability strategy, driving asset performance and conformance to site standards. You will effectively implement World Class Best Maintenance practices in a way that meets all Kimberly Clark standards and processes.


Responsibilities

  • Maintain equipment associated with the production, packaging and distribution through preventative, predictive and corrective maintenance work.

  • Diagnose the cause of technical malfunction or failure of operational equipment and apply adequate resolutions following work instructions.

  • Prepare and lead planned maintenance activities, including all scheduled planned maintenance shutdowns.

  • Demonstrate and drive the 3 Safety Obligations.

  • Support a 24 hour call in rota and work flexible hours outside of normal day hours to cover business needs and shortfalls within the team.


Qualifications

  • Minimum of 4 GCSEs (or equivalent) including Mathematics and English.

  • Working towards or having achieved an HNC/HND (or equivalent) in Electrical Engineering.

  • Computer literacy skills.

  • Hands on approach to problem solving, flexibility and experience in an FMCG process, tissue or heavy engineering environment.

  • Strong awareness for safety and ability to work in a high speed production environment.
